There are many different types of cat flaps available. Each one has its own benefits and features. There are manual flaps that come with a standard key and microchip-activated cat flaps that recognize your cat's microchip and magnetic key flaps that respond to the magnet on its collar. There are also remote-controlled cat flaps that can be operated by a mobile app that gives you additional security and control over your pet's access.
A standard cat flap is a basic choice that offers a minimum amount of security. If you're concerned about the safety of your cat, a flap with a lock might be a better choice. You can lock the flap at any time, like during your vacation or at night.
It is generally recommended to not install a cat-flap at the main entrance of your home. This can reduce the security of your home. This is due to burglars being able to easily get through the opening in your front door, which allows them to open it and gain entry into your home. But, you can limit this risk by having the cat flap installed on the wall that is away from your door or by selecting the lockable model.
It's advisable to discuss your security options with a professional, who will be able to provide you with the best cat flap for your needs, and also suggest options that offer greater security. You should also check with your insurance company for your home to determine if a cat flap installed can affect your insurance policy.
